Output 3954fbf220da01f11b3d45eeb359619f4a830fc58e6e4e5730f1adb18f3a896a:0

value
19825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013c0c46eb8ddef15bb001ed077fd72bad64f3c5 OP_EQUAL
address
31oYXwX5HHuDa3wcEakhnnrcc2BCVZwNh4
transaction
3954fbf220da01f11b3d45eeb359619f4a830fc58e6e4e5730f1adb18f3a896a
confirmations
120870
spent
true